成人在线你懂的-成人在线免费小视频-成人在线免费网站-成人在线免费视频观看-日韩精品国产一区二区-日韩精品国产一区

掃一掃
關(guān)注微信公眾號(hào)

SQL Server 2005:如何在多維數(shù)據(jù)集中設(shè)置訪問(wèn)權(quán)限
2007-07-29   IT168 

對(duì)于訪問(wèn)控制需求(這里以SQL Server 2005自帶的示例說(shuō)明)有如下說(shuō)明:假設(shè)Adventure Works Cycles將全球的銷(xiāo)售按國(guó)家和地區(qū)分為不同的分公司(Australia分公司、Canada分公司、France分公司、Germany分公司、United Kingdom分公司、United States分公司),總公司CEO可以看到每個(gè)分公司的銷(xiāo)售情況,分公司的經(jīng)理只能看到自己所在的分公司的銷(xiāo)售情況。分析需求可以得知,實(shí)際上需要根據(jù)用戶(hù)來(lái)決定用戶(hù)訪問(wèn)的數(shù)據(jù),可以利用SQL Server 2005 Analysis Service中定義角色的方式來(lái)控制。

定義角色可以在多維數(shù)據(jù)集開(kāi)發(fā)環(huán)境中定義,也可以完成多維數(shù)集部署之后在數(shù)據(jù)庫(kù)服務(wù)器端定義。

多維數(shù)據(jù)集角色是一類(lèi)訪問(wèn)權(quán)限的集合,可以在角色中定義屬于這個(gè)角色的用戶(hù)能訪問(wèn)什么數(shù)據(jù),不能訪問(wèn)什么數(shù)據(jù)。定義了角色之后,可以為這個(gè)角色添加成員,成員是服務(wù)器Windwos賬戶(hù)或者是域賬戶(hù)。當(dāng)某個(gè)角色賦于某個(gè)成員之后,客戶(hù)端使用該用戶(hù)登陸的時(shí)候,只能看到角色中定義的權(quán)限訪問(wèn)多維數(shù)據(jù)集。如果在開(kāi)發(fā)環(huán)境定義的角色必須先保存然后部署才能生效。

下面具體介紹設(shè)置方法(前臺(tái)測(cè)試工具用普科(ProClarity)):

1、新建Windows測(cè)試賬戶(hù)“Jeffrey”。不要定義成Administrator組,因?yàn)锳dministrator組的用戶(hù)自動(dòng)擁有訪問(wèn)多維數(shù)集的權(quán)限。

2、打開(kāi)Analysis Servie 項(xiàng)目工程,在角色列表項(xiàng)中單擊右鍵新建角色,打開(kāi)新建角色對(duì)框。

3、設(shè)置訪問(wèn)權(quán)限(如圖1)。

""498)this.style.width=498;">

圖1

這里只需要讀取數(shù)據(jù),如果用戶(hù)需要有要處理更新cube時(shí),可以根據(jù)需要進(jìn)行設(shè)置。

""498)this.style.width=498;">

圖2

5、設(shè)置多維數(shù)據(jù)集訪問(wèn)權(quán)限,選擇“讀”,本地鉆取選擇“鉆取”(如圖3)

""498)this.style.width=498;">

圖3


6、選擇維度數(shù)據(jù)選項(xiàng)卡,選擇維度中的“Customer”維度(如圖4)。

""498)this.style.width=498;">

圖4

7、 假設(shè)為Australia分公司定義權(quán)限,角色定義了只能訪問(wèn)區(qū)域?yàn)锳ustralia的數(shù)據(jù)(如圖5),在高級(jí)選項(xiàng)卡可以寫(xiě)mdx進(jìn)行成員的選擇。在成員列列中選擇“Australi”。

""498)this.style.width=498;">

圖5

8、 選擇“成員身份”選項(xiàng)卡,單擊“添加”,在彈出的對(duì)話(huà)框中輸入“Jeffrey”(Windows用戶(hù)),檢查名稱(chēng)之后如圖6所示。

""498)this.style.width=498;">

圖6

9、完成上面的步驟之后,保存,部署就設(shè)置完成。

設(shè)置成功這后,客戶(hù)端軟件(Reporting Service,或ProClarity )以Jeffery用戶(hù)連上多維數(shù)據(jù)集,就只能訪問(wèn)Australi的數(shù)據(jù)如圖7。

""498)this.style.width=498;">

圖7

以Jeffery用戶(hù)登陸,customer下的區(qū)域維度所有成員只有Australi,成功的限制Jeffery用戶(hù)只能訪問(wèn)Australi數(shù)據(jù)。

熱詞搜索:

上一篇:2007年上半年十大病毒及疫情報(bào)告
下一篇:SQL Server數(shù)據(jù)倉(cāng)庫(kù)相關(guān)概念及構(gòu)建流程

分享到: 收藏
主站蜘蛛池模板: 穆丹| 热天午后| 房事性生活| 蛇花| 自拍在线播放| 免费看污视频在线观看| dj舞曲超劲爆dj| 墨多多谜境冒险30册免费阅读| 只要有你还珠格格| 《哥哥的女人》电影| 10000个卫视频道| 挠60分钟美女腋窝视频| 速度与激情 电影| 初号机壁纸| 裸色亮片| 少女集中营阅读| 误杀2演员| 六年级下册语文第15课课堂笔记| 俺去也电影网| 玫瑰情人| 普罗米修斯 电影| 湖北特产| 炊事班的故事演员表| 五行字库查询表| 凤凰情 电影| 欧美喜剧电影| 电视剧零下三十八度手机免费观看| 继承者计划 电视剧| 山本裕典| 行尸走肉电影| 雌雄同体seoⅹ另类| 希比·布拉奇克| 露底| 桥梁工程施工方案| 荡女奇行| 榜上有名| 拾贝的小女孩阅读理解答案| 红海行动2在线观看| 小娘惹电视连续剧48集剧情| 防冲撞应急处置预案| 小镇追凶电影免费观看|